A woman was left feeling "sick and confused" when a uniformed police officer asked her for sex and suggested she arranged a "threesome", a tribunal heard.
The woman, known as Miss A, told a hearing on Monday how Pc Darren Booth began flirting with her before saying he wanted to "meet up on a regular basis to have sex".
She said the officer then told her "and if you could get someone else involved it would be even better", before arranging to meet her after his shift.
But Miss A, 36, said she reported the planned meeting on the 101 number and, after they went to her flat, Pc Booth's colleagues arrived to escort him away.
